Associate Producer – Online Game (MMORPG) Publishing & Operations (sunnyvale)

Gala-Net, Inc. is looking for an Associate Producer to join our MMORPG publishing company and help launch and grow our new game title. We are four years old, profitable, and boast some of the highest performing MMORPGs in the world. We have a collaborative and energetic startup work culture, and we’re looking for creative and driven personalities.

As an Associate Producer, you will be assigned to our game team where you’ll have a direct hands-on role in launching a new title and managing the day-to-day operations. You will need to use your experience, passion and leadership skills to lead a game operation team, maximize exposure of the title, and provide the best possible to the players while maximizing profitability and contributing the game’s future development.

This position has a significant opportunity for growth and advancement. We offer a competitive salary and full benefits, including medical, dental, vision, and PTO.


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
• Ensure localization process and ongoing improvements, working effectively with internal teams, such as marketing, and web development, and external developer
• Support managing and ensuring effective game operations, including team management, community management, customer service, scheduling, quality assurance, sales, budget planning, third-party relations, and promotions
• Create and maintain a high level of player satisfaction and retention
• Analyze statistical data and quantify players’ opinions, ensuring the balance among CCU, play time, and unique visitors to achieve sales goals
• Identify, plan, create and execute community events to build and maintain players’ excitement
• Hire, train, and manage game operations team

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:
• Understand Game Master / Community Management / Producer roles in game publishing business
• Know and play many online games, especially MMORPGs
• Familiar with gaming & internet subcultures (anime, manga, comics, PC hardware, etc.)
• 2+ years of experience in gaming industry, either in development or publishing
• Able to manage time efficiently and prioritize tasks
• Able to effectively communicate (verbal and written) with internal teams and external parties
• Energetic, ambitious and charismatic
• Must be comfortable with startup culture and hours
